Literally: “If this can be tolerated, what cannot?”.

Etymology

From the Analects, Book 3 (《論語·八佾》):

孔子季氏:「八佾是可忍孰不可忍?」
孔子季氏:「八佾是可忍孰不可忍?」
From: The Analects of Confucius, c. 475 – 221 BCE, translated based on James Legge's version
Kǒngzǐ wèi Jì shì: “Bāyì wǔ yú tíng, shì kě rěn yě, shú bùkě rěn yě?”
Confucius said of the head of the Ji family (w:zh:季平子), who had eight rows of pantomimes in his area, "If he can bear to do this, what may he not bear to do?"
